SoH/tDC is a psycho-geographical social sculpture. The Deterritorialized Church is the second movement to the Sanctuary of Hope, an antinomian church in Ridgewood, Queens based on the anthropological and economic studies of Georges Bataille. The project was conceived upon the adoption of a found corner-store church, abandoned after a fire. We moved in one year after the fire and decided to rebuild the church in our likeness.
The Deterritorialized Church is both a break from, as well as a continuation of the Sanctuary of Hope. Having legally surrendered the site of its inception, the project has taken on a Deleuzian nomadic structure, hosting unique social experimentations through a curatorship of situations. These situations or reterritorializations are examinations of disused, donated, or disregarded spaces with the social and material elements of the church reconfigured onto them. They may take the form of lines of flight, revivals, witnessings, becomings or zoological recontextualizations.
